What is an ITIL manager?

ITIL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ing the implementation and management of ITIL (Information Technology Infrastructure Library) processes within an organization. They ensure that IT services are delivered effectively by aligning IT service management practices with the needs of the business. Their duties typically include designing, monitoring, and optimizing ITIL processes such as incident, problem, and change management. ITIL Managers also lead teams, train staff, and ensure compliance with ITIL best practices to improve service quality. They play a key role in driving continuous improvement in IT service delivery.

What is the difference between Itil Manager vs Service Delivery Manager?

AspectItil ManagerService Delivery Manager
CertificationsITIL certifications, such as ITIL Foundation or ExpertITIL certifications often preferred; certifications in service management or project management (e.g., PMP) are common
Work EnvironmentFocuses on IT service management processes, frameworks, and improving IT servicesOversees end-to-end service delivery, including customer satisfaction and operational performance
Industry UsagePrimarily in IT and technology sectorsUsed across various industries including IT, telecom, and service-based sectors

The Itil Manager specializes in managing IT service management processes based on ITIL frameworks, ensuring efficient IT operations. The Service Delivery Manager has a broader focus on overall service delivery, customer satisfaction, and operational performance across multiple functions. While both roles require ITIL knowledge, the Itil Manager is more process-oriented, whereas the Service Delivery Manager emphasizes service quality and client relationships.
